Maple Zone boys’ recruit: Malvern Prep rising senior attackman Dunn commits to Marquette

July 12, 2012 by Chris Goldberg

By Chris Goldberg
Phillylacrosse.com, Posted 7/12/12

Malvern Prep rising senior attackman Joseph Dunn has committed to play Division I lacrosse at Marquette University.

Joe Dunn log:

Joe Dunn

High School: Malvern Prep

Graduation Year: 2013

Position: Attack

College Choice: Marquette

Club Affiliations: Headstrong, Mesa Fresh

Major lacrosse honors: Philly Showcase All-Star, EPSLA, Adrenaline Black Card Showcase

Academic Honors: First Honors

What will you major in/study? Finance

Why did you choose Marquette? “The number one factor in making my decision to attend Marquette, was definitely the academic reputation and challenge afforded by such an elite institution.

“I was extremely impressed by the entire coaching staff. It is clear to me that Coach (Joe) Amplo has put together an extremely competent staff poised to make us very competitive right out of the gate. In particular, I am excited to be part of the core foundation of a new D1 lacrosse program at Marquette. Playing in the big east was also a huge enticement.”

Other schools considered: Saint Joseph’s, Villanova, Rutgers

HS outlook for 2013 season? “While we did lose some very talented players to graduation, I feel that overall we will be more successful next year. Our schedule in 2012 was as tough as any schedule could be. I firmly believe however, that we are a better team having experienced competition at that level for entire an season. Additionally, we have some great young talent to fill the spots vacated by our seniors. Coach (David) Metz will have us ready to compete for the InterAc Championship next year.”
